The U.S. military late Thursday ET announce the U.S. and U.K. strikes that targeted Houthi rebels in parts of Yemen that the militant group controls.
Gen. Michael Erik Kurilla, commander of U.S. Central Command, said in a statement that attacks on shipping by the Houthis “will not be tolerated, and they will be held accountable.”
